I first noticed the object (only 1 object) on 10/11/08 - 10/13/08 between 8:30pm and 9:30pm. The object was sphere shaped and changed colors (blue, red & white). It moved rapidly up and down and from left to right sometimes it got much brighter. The background was the night sky. It was located in the southeastern sky from 10/14 through 10/15.

I didn't see the object on Thursday (10/16/08--probably because it was raining).

The object (only 1 object) was seen again on Friday (10/17/08) and looked to be in the northeast sky and the object is described as the one above. The time it was seen was approximately 11:45pm -1:20am.

The object was seen tonight (10/18/08)this time there were (2) both were located in the northern sky but one was further to the left than the other. The same shape, colors, brightness, up and down, from left to right and the erratic and rapid movement. This one was witnessed by my son.

All sightings were seen at night. I don't know if it could have been a weather balloon but it was something that didn't move like an airplane or helicopter.




NUFORC Note:

Possible "twinkling" star. PD
